Enterprise Technical Architect - Applications, Archer Daniels Midland Company, Erlanger, KY. Develop the technical design of application solutions, including cloud-native architectures. Define solution requirements and create conceptual, high-level, and low-level design artifacts. Support the Cloud Center of Excellence (CoE) and review solutions to ensure alignment with design and architectural requirements. Research, experiment, and prototype new cloud application services. Develop and maintain technical and architectural standards. Ensure adherence to defined architecture guidelines throughout the application development lifecycle. Provide guidance and technical coaching to developers as part of the Architecture Services Organization. Utilize subject matter expertise to design, develop, and implement technical architectures in alignment with Enterprise Architecture direction and standards. Stay current with industry trends and leverage this knowledge to inform IT and business stakeholders on opportunities to improve target architectures and support strategic decision-making. Support IT enterprise governance functions, including RFIs, vendor risk assessments, and related evaluations.
40 hrs/week, Mon-Fri, 8:30 a.m. - 5:30 p.m.
Requirements
Bachelor's degree or foreign equivalent degree in Information Systems, Engineering (any), Business, or a related field, and five (5) years of post-bachelor's, progressive, related work experience.
Must have three (3) years of experience with/in:
-
Building solutions using modern application design patterns including serverless applications, containerized applications, SOA applications, web service applications, and RESTful patterned applications;
-
Information Technology technical design;
-
Application development using Microsoft development platforms;
-
Generating conceptual and high-level architecture design artifacts;
-
Conducting design and architecture reviews;
-
Network architecture, Modern integration architectures, Security architecture, and Identity management;
-
Developing cloud solutions using Azure services such as App Service, Azure Functions, API Management, Application Gateway, Logic Apps, Container Apps, and Azure Service Bus;
-
Containerization using Docker and orchestration platforms;
-
Source Code Management tools such as Git, GitHub, SVN, or Gitlab; and
-
Relational and NoSQL database such as SQL Server or Cosmos DB.
Telecommuting permitted on a hybrid schedule as determined by the employer.
